Mark Movie Review: What's Good, What's Bad In Sudeep's Film? Find Out
Following the success of Max, Kiccha Sudeep has teamed up with Vijay Karthikeyaa again for his latest movie Mark. The Kannada movie is hitting the screens on Thursday, December 25.
The movie has Shine Tom Chacko, Naveen Chandra, Vikranth, Yogi Babu, Guru Somasundaram, Nishvika Naidu, and Roshini Prakash.

The technical crew brings together notable talent, with music composed by B. Ajaneesh Loknath, cinematography handled by Shekar Chandra, and editing by S. R. Ganesh Babu.
Mark Story & Review
The film opens with an intriguing introduction to Mark, played by Kichcha Sudeep, setting a tone that is equal parts mystery and energy. While Sudeep initially electrifies the audience with his signature dance moves, the story quickly shifts gears into a gritty world of crime and corruption.
The narrative is a complex web of three major threads: a sinister child kidnapping racket, a high-stakes conspiracy to seize the Chief Minister's chair, and a pair of lovers on the run. At the center of this chaos is Mark, a suspended police officer. Because he is under suspension, Sudeep trades the traditional khaki uniform for a "mass" avatar, sporting stylish costumes and a distinct look that is sure to delight his fanbase.
With no leads and the clock ticking, Mark embarks on a desperate search for the missing children. Simultaneously, he must secure evidence against a villainous political aspirant aiming for the CM's seat. The mission is further complicated by internal deception; Mark's own team harbors moles, ensuring that every time he nears a breakthrough, a new twist resets the board.
Directorially, the film makes a conscious effort to elevate a somewhat familiar "cat-and-mouse" plot through stylized presentation. The cinematography, particularly the night sequences, is atmospheric and sharp. The Background Music (BGM) complements Sudeep's "swag" perfectly, amplifying his screen presence.
Sudeep's mannerisms and effortless style are the film's strongest assets. Even without the uniform, he commands the screen as a formidable force of justice.

Finder: #MarkTheFilm opens with a strong and engaging setup, setting the tone with an impactful introduction. The film establishes its world effectively, supported by good production values and a solid technical foundation. The first half moves at a measured pace, building characters and setting the narrative base.
The second half begins with an investigation track, which slows the pace slightly but keeps the audience engaged through layered storytelling and controlled tension. The narrative gradually unfolds, maintaining interest through its treatment rather than relying on loud moments. The writing balances suspense and emotion well, giving the film a grounded feel.
Kiccha Sudeep once again proves why he remains one of the most dependable performers in the industry. His screen presence, dialogue delivery, and controlled intensity elevate several key moments. He carries the film with ease, especially during the investigation and confrontation sequences.
Director Vijay Kartikeyaa handles the subject with maturity. His storytelling is steady, and his vision is clear throughout. The film benefits from his structured narration and restraint, avoiding unnecessary distractions and focusing on the core plot.
Ajaneesh B Loknath's background score is one of the biggest strengths of the film. His music enhances the mood without overpowering scenes, especially during emotional and suspense-driven moments.
Cinematographer Shekar Chandra deserves credit for the clean visuals and well-composed frames that add depth and realism to the narrative.
Overall, #MarkTheFilm stands out for its strong performances, solid technical values, and disciplined storytelling. While it takes a measured approach, the film stays engaging and leaves a positive impact, especially for audiences who enjoy grounded thrillers.
